Description:
A capstone course which engages the student in the discussion of professional issues and behaviors related to clinical practice and which prepares the student for transition into the workforce. Prerequisites: PTHA 1321, PTHA 2205, PTHA 2431 and PTHA 2435. [Offered spring semester to second year PTA students.] Type: Tech
